dvgrab version 1.01, August 08, 2001
(c) 2000-2001 Arne Schirmacher <dvgrab@schirmacher.de>
dvgrab website: http://www.schirmacher.de/arne/dvgrab/


To use the program, turn on the camera and run the program:

dvgrab --frames 200 myfilm

If you have properly configured your kernel and your ieee1394 device
drivers, you should end up with about 30 MByte of DV image data nicely
packed in a file myfilm001.avi (digits and extension automatically
appended), which can be displayed with the Microsoft Media Player or a
similar program (remember to install the required DV codecs, software
should be included with your hardware).

Use the program at your own risk. The ieee1394 subsystem is still
experimental. Do not use any ieee1394 related software on a system
that you cannot afford to lose.

My personal hardware / software configuration:

	- a Linux 2.2.18 or 2.4.0 kernel or later

	- the latest ieee1394 related drivers and libraries on the
	  GNU IEEE1394 website (http://linux1394.sourceforge.net)

	- an EX-6500 interface card (http://www.exsys.com.tw
	  or http://www.exsys.de)

	- a Sony PC100E digital video camera (PAL)

	- a PC with 64 MByte RAM, an AMD 333 MHz,
	  a 10 GByte disk drive solely for the movie files.
	  The load is approx. 50% with this configuration.
